Ontario's walled regulated market

Ontario is different from every other province covered on this site. Since April 2022 the province has operated a closed, regulated iGaming market: operators must register with the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O) and hold a commercial agreement with iGaming Ontario before they can legally offer online casino or sportsbook to Ontario residents. That is what "walled" means - only registered brands are inside the wall.

Why Leon Casino sits outside it

Leon Gaming Limited holds a Curacao Master Licence No. 8048/JAZ and Kahnawake Gaming Commission oversight. Neither is an Ontario registration. Because Leon operates from offshore and has not been listed as a registered iGaming Ontario operator, it falls outside Ontario's regulated framework. The legal split, stated carefully

The honest description is a two-track system. Inside the wall sit operators registered with the AGCO through iGaming Ontario, which is the regulated market Ontario intends players to use. Outside it sit offshore brands such as Leon, whose Curacao and Kahnawake licences do not extend into Ontario's regulated market. Where the regulated list actually lives

If you want the operators that are legally cleared for Ontario, the authoritative sources are iGaming Ontario and the AGCO. Those bodies publish which brands are registered; an offshore review page is not a substitute for that register. Confirm any operator against them before you decide anything.

Is Leon Casino legal in Ontario?

Leon Casino is not registered in Ontario's regulated market. Ontario runs a walled iGaming market through iGaming Ontario and the AGCO, and only registered operators are inside it. Leon operates offshore under a Curacao licence (No. 8048/JAZ) and Kahnawake oversight, outside that framework. For the legal operator list, consult iGaming Ontario and the AGCO.

What is iGaming Ontario?

iGaming Ontario is the entity that manages Ontario's regulated online gambling market, working with the AGCO. Operators must register with the AGCO and hold an agreement with iGaming Ontario to legally serve Ontario residents.

Why is Leon Casino considered offshore for Ontario?

Leon Gaming Limited is licensed in Curacao (No. 8048/JAZ) with Kahnawake Gaming Commission oversight, not registered through iGaming Ontario or the AGCO. That places it outside Ontario's walled regulated market.

Where can I find operators licensed for Ontario?

The authoritative sources are iGaming Ontario (igamingontario.ca) and the AGCO (agco.ca), which publish the registered operators for the province.
